
掌握ASP.NET与数据库操作:动态网站开发课程设计
下载需积分: 12 | 285KB |
更新于2025-06-23
| 95 浏览量 | 举报
收藏
在当前的信息技术教育中,WEB开发与应用课程设计是十分重要的实践环节,它要求学生不仅掌握基础理论知识,还要能够在实践中运用所学知识解决实际问题。从给定的文件信息中,我们可以提炼出以下知识点:
1. 动态网页制作技术
动态网页制作是构建交互式网站的核心技术,它涉及到服务器端脚本的运行,以及客户端脚本的交互。动态网页能够根据用户的请求提供个性化的信息。常见的动态网页技术包括ASP.NET、PHP、JSP等。
2. ASP.NET编程回顾
ASP.NET是一个用于网页开发的服务器端技术,它允许开发者使用.NET框架编写动态网页、网络应用和网络服务。在本次课程设计中,学生回顾了ASP.NET的基础知识,这可能包括其运行机制、语法结构、常用的控件以及事件驱动编程模型。
3. 数据库操作知识学习
数据库是WEB应用的不可或缺部分,用于存储用户数据、应用数据等。学生在这次课程设计中学习了数据库操作的基本知识,这包括但不限于:SQL语言基础、数据库设计原则、数据的增删改查操作、以及如何在ASP.NET中连接和操作数据库。
4. 小型动态网站开发
开发一个小型动态网站是WEB开发课程设计的目标之一,学生通过实践,将理论知识与实际需求相结合。小型动态网站开发涉及前端页面设计、后端逻辑实现、数据库设计等多个方面。在本次设计中,学生学习了如何运用ASP.NET技术来构建网站的后台,实现网站的功能需求。
5. 发现与解决问题能力的提高
在网站开发过程中,学生会遇到各种问题,例如代码错误、系统崩溃、功能实现等。通过课程设计,学生能够提高在实际开发中遇到问题时的分析和解决能力,这是软件开发实践中的重要技能。
6. WEB开发的其他相关技术
尽管在本次课程设计中重点介绍了ASP.NET,但WEB开发是一个涉及多种技术的领域。学生可能还接触到了其他WEB开发相关技术,如HTML、CSS、JavaScript等前端技术,以及可能涉及的服务器配置、网站部署、网络安全等相关知识。
7. WEB课程设计的目的与意义
WEB课程设计不仅在于提升学生的编程技能,更重要的是培养学生的创新意识、团队协作能力和项目管理能力。在课程设计中,学生往往需要以小组为单位完成一个具有实际意义的项目,这样可以锻炼学生的综合运用知识的能力,为日后的职业发展打下坚实的基础。
综上所述,WEB开发与应用课程设计是一个综合性的学习过程,它旨在通过实践项目,让学生在实际开发过程中,深入理解和应用WEB开发的相关知识,从而为学生未来从事IT相关工作打下坚实的基础。通过这一过程,学生不仅学会了如何开发一个小型的动态网站,还提升了自己在实际工作中解决问题的能力,为成为合格的WEB开发者奠定了基础。
相关推荐








maomao9955
- 粉丝: 0
最新资源
- PBKiller 2.5.18:强大的PowerBuilder反编译工具
- 深入探讨Oracle培训资料的核心内容
- Java实现Excel数据导入数据库的示例代码
- 实现菜单伸缩效果的JavaScript脚本教程
- OpenGL编程实现飘动美国旗帜教程
- 电气工程设计规范查询系统的便捷性
- 掌握串口通信:C++/C#编程实例合集
- 深入了解Spring2.5框架及其实现
- 围棋学习软件v1.90更新:增强算法与功能
- C#.Net实现Socket网络聊天室实例教程
- 掌握Shell编程艺术:高级bash脚本指南双语版
- 高效管理QQ好友:一键快速删除工具
- Open Flash Chart 2.0发布:最强开源图表组件
- VF编写的工资管理系统成功转为可执行文件
- U盘病毒清理利器-Uclear工具95K轻巧下载
- 66KB绿色工具:瞬间恢复被病毒隐藏文件夹
- U盘芯片检测工具ChipGenius_090406使用介绍
- J2ME手机游戏开发技术系列PPT教程
- 徐全智老师编程与数据库课件精讲
- C#实现无边框可移动Winform窗体技巧
- Cisco IOS全版本种子文件打包下载
- 孙鑫VC++6.0教程第一课源代码详解
- 鸿达公司客户管理系统:开发实现与管理效率提升
- 周兴华单片机自学教程:中频电源设计与优化